Rajesh Khanna watched Nishi Padma 24 times to play his role in Amar Prem

The superhit Hindi film Amar Prem starring Rajesh Khanna and Sharmila Tagore was released 50 years ago. Directed by Shakti Samanta, the film also starred Sujit Kumar, Vinod Mehra and Om Prakash. The songs of Amar Prem, including Kuch To Log Kahenge, Raina Beti Jate, released on 28 January 1972,

Chingari Koi Phatke, Yeh Kya Hua, Bada Natkhat Hai became instant hits, some of the dialogues of this movie are also quite famous. The film completed 50 years of its release today.

Amar Prem was a remake of the 1970 Bengali film Nishi Padma. The Bengali film, directed by Aurobindo Mukherjee, was based on the story of Vibhutibhushan Bandyopadhyay, Hingar Kochuri. Aurobindo Mukherjee wrote scripts for both Hindi and Bengali films.

According to media reports, Rajesh Khanna had seen Nishi Padma not once or twice but a total of 24 times to play this role. And as a result of Rajesh Khanna’s hard work, the film is much loved by the cine-lovers.

Rajesh Khanna’s performance did wonders for the audience, and it was one of the highest-grossing films of that year.
